Transcribed Image Text:Ql: Assume we have a CPU Register File that consists of two registers, each
register is 16 bits length and the Register File has two read ports and one write
port.
(a) Draw the structure of the Register file.
(b) Determine the width in bits of the read and write ports.
(c) Determine the width in bits of the RS1, RS2, and RD inputs.
